Understanding THCA rosin begins with recognizing it as a solventless concentrate made by applying heat and pressure to high-quality, trichome-rich cannabis flower or hash. The appeal lies in its purity and full-spectrum profile; the process preserves the plant’s original terpenes and cannabinoids, including the non-psychoactive THCA. When heated, THCA converts to THC, offering a potent and flavorful experience. Its clean extraction method strongly appeals to connoisseurs seeking a product free of residual solvents, prioritizing flavor and a holistic effect. This focus on cannabis purity makes it a premier choice for discerning consumers.
Q: Is THCA rosin psychoactive?
A: In its raw form, THCA is non-psychoactive. It only becomes psychoactive THC when decarboxylated through heat, such as when dabbed or vaporized.

The price of rosin isn’t just random; it’s driven by a few key factors in the cannabis concentrate market. First, the quality of the starting material is huge—top-shelf, trichome-rich flower costs more and yields better rosin. The specific extraction method (like using a heat press versus more industrial tech) also impacts cost. Market demand plays a big role, with limited small-batch releases often carrying a premium.
Ultimately, you’re paying for the skill of the extractor to turn that premium flower into a perfect, solventless dab.
Finally, don’t forget overhead—things like lab testing, packaging, and state taxes all get factored into the final sticker price.
